Abstract
The effects of acid rain on stone monuments are summarized. The basic chemistry of acid rain and its interaction with calcite (CaCO* l3*s) based on stone, marble and limestone, is presented. Factors affecting calcite dissolution, the problems of calcium sulfate (gypsum) formation and subsequent discoloration, and mechanical damage from soluble salts are also introduced.
